质点模型定义在生物信息学中有何应用?
质点模型在生物信息学中的应用
随着科学技术的不断发展,生物信息学已成为一门跨学科的研究领域,其研究内容涵盖了生物学、计算机科学、数学等多个领域。在生物信息学的研究中,质点模型作为一种重要的数学工具,被广泛应用于基因序列分析、蛋白质结构预测、生物系统建模等领域。本文将探讨质点模型在生物信息学中的具体应用。
一、基因序列分析
- 序列比对
质点模型在基因序列分析中主要用于序列比对,通过比较两个或多个基因序列之间的相似性,从而发现潜在的基因功能、进化关系等信息。常见的序列比对方法有动态规划算法、基于局部比对的方法等。
(1)动态规划算法:利用质点模型,可以将序列比对问题转化为一个二维动态规划表,通过比较相邻两个质点之间的相似性,计算最优比对路径。常见的动态规划算法有Needleman-Wunsch算法、Smith-Waterman算法等。
(2)基于局部比对的方法:通过寻找两个序列中高度相似的局部区域,分析这些区域之间的进化关系。常见的局部比对方法有BLAST、FASTA等。
- 基因结构预测
质点模型在基因结构预测中的应用主要体现在对基因编码区、非编码区等结构的识别。通过将基因序列划分为一系列质点,分析质点之间的相互作用,从而预测基因的功能和结构。
(1)编码区预测:通过分析基因序列中的质点,判断编码区和非编码区。常见的编码区预测方法有隐马尔可夫模型(HMM)、支持向量机(SVM)等。
(2)非编码区预测:通过分析基因序列中的质点,预测非编码区的功能。常见的非编码区预测方法有基于统计模型的方法、基于机器学习的方法等。
二、蛋白质结构预测
蛋白质结构预测是生物信息学的重要研究方向之一。质点模型在蛋白质结构预测中的应用主要体现在以下几个方面:
- 蛋白质结构相似性搜索
通过将蛋白质结构表示为一系列质点,利用质点之间的相似性,搜索与目标蛋白质具有相似结构的蛋白质,从而预测目标蛋白质的结构。
- 蛋白质折叠模拟
利用质点模型模拟蛋白质折叠过程,分析蛋白质结构形成过程中的关键步骤和相互作用。常见的蛋白质折叠模拟方法有蒙特卡洛模拟、分子动力学模拟等。
- 蛋白质-蛋白质相互作用预测
通过分析蛋白质结构中的质点,预测蛋白质之间的相互作用。常见的蛋白质-蛋白质相互作用预测方法有图论方法、机器学习方法等。
三、生物系统建模
质点模型在生物系统建模中的应用主要体现在以下几个方面:
- 神经网络建模
通过将神经元表示为质点,分析神经元之间的相互作用,建立神经网络模型,研究神经系统的信息处理过程。
- 代谢网络建模
将代谢网络中的反应物和产物表示为质点,分析质点之间的反应速率和平衡常数,建立代谢网络模型,研究生物体内的代谢过程。
- 生态系统建模
将生态系统中的物种、环境因素等表示为质点,分析质点之间的相互作用,建立生态系统模型,研究生态系统的稳定性和演化规律。
总结
质点模型作为一种重要的数学工具,在生物信息学中具有广泛的应用。通过对基因序列、蛋白质结构、生物系统等进行质点建模,可以揭示生物体内的复杂现象和规律。随着生物信息学的发展,质点模型在生物信息学中的应用将越来越广泛,为生物科学研究提供有力的支持。
猜你喜欢:战略解码引导